The Maven Girl 100-120 23/24 by Atomic is a youth ski designed to help young skiers build carving skills on the slopes. Offered in a 110 cm length with matching bindings, it’s aimed at smaller riders looking to gain confidence on groomed runs.
This ski features an 8-meter turn radius and a 105/67/86 mm sidecut that make turning more approachable at slower speeds. Weighing around 1.4 kg per ski, it stays light underfoot so little legs won’t tire as quickly. The included Atomic C 5 GW binding (75 mm brake) provides a straightforward step-in fit and reliable release when needed.
The turn radius indicates the size of the arc the ski naturally follows—a smaller radius of 8 m helps create tighter, more responsive turns. Sidecut measurements refer to the width at the tip, waist and tail; a narrower waist compared to the tip and tail lets the ski bend smoothly into a controlled turn without requiring excessive effort.

On or off piste, the Atomic Maven Girl 100-120 is designed for girls aged 5-8 and makes progressing super fun. Bend-X Technology and All Mountain Rocker lets young all-rounders make controlled turns effortlessly: the special flex zone in the binding area allows young skiers to bend the ski easily for full contact with the snow at all times, regardless of their weight. The Maven Girl 100-120 models are a little wider than the Maven Girl 70-90 and with more sidecut. The geometry is precisely tailored to the respective length of the ski, so every young skier can shred the mountain with the ski that is exactly the right fit.
